DTC "C28" (P1655): Secondary Throttle Valve Actuator (STVA) Malfunction

Detected Condition and Possible Cause
Detected Condition
The operation voltage does not reach the STVA.
ECM does not receive communication signal from the
STVA. STVA can not operate properly.

Possible Cause
• STVA malfunction.
• STVA circuit open or short.
• STVA motor malfunction.
